Police pursue Porsche on Highway 30 at high speeds, Cockrell Hill TX


Police pursued a Porsche traveling eastbound on Highway 30 at high speeds with moderate to light traffic. The pursuit involved multiple officers coordinating and passed several exits including MacArthur, Cockrell Hill, Beckley Avenue, and Riverfront in Dallas. Air support was unavailable. Officers attempted maneuvers to stop the vehicle and took custody of the suspect near Brook River Drive.
